summaryrefslogtreecommitdiff
path: root/.travis.yml
diff options
context:
space:
mode:
authorgfyoung <gfyoung17@gmail.com>2016-06-08 13:46:32 +0100
committergfyoung <gfyoung17@gmail.com>2016-10-24 11:26:46 -0400
commit52f761d6ee094a8dde25ffc9e4c08dad51b61ae0 (patch)
tree1801b455e52fe5dfb29ddca900f9a11dd4d810f5 /.travis.yml
parent3bd79ab568856678139fa4d7ca272e7cbd05e1ad (diff)
downloadnumpy-52f761d6ee094a8dde25ffc9e4c08dad51b61ae0.tar.gz
BUG, TST: Fix python3-dbg bug in Travis script
With USE_DEBUG=1, the wrong python was being used to create the virtualenv, meaning that installed packages (e.g. Cython) were being installed to the wrong location.
Diffstat (limited to '.travis.yml')
-rw-r--r--.travis.yml22
1 files changed, 1 insertions, 21 deletions
diff --git a/.travis.yml b/.travis.yml
index 58fc8415e..5f5bf9757 100644
--- a/.travis.yml
+++ b/.travis.yml
@@ -71,27 +71,7 @@ matrix:
- PYTHONOPTIMIZE=2
- USE_ASV=1
before_install:
- - uname -a
- - free -m
- - df -h
- - ulimit -a
- - mkdir builds
- - pushd builds
- # Build into own virtualenv
- # We therefore control our own environment, avoid travis' numpy
- #
- # Some change in virtualenv 14.0.5 caused `test_f2py` to fail. So, we have
- # pinned `virtualenv` to the last known working version to avoid this failure.
- # Appears we had some issues with certificates on Travis. It looks like
- # bumping to 14.0.6 will help.
- - pip install -U 'virtualenv==14.0.6'
- - virtualenv --python=python venv
- - source venv/bin/activate
- - python -V
- - pip install --upgrade pip setuptools
- - pip install nose pytz cython
- - if [ -n "$USE_ASV" ]; then pip install asv; fi
- - popd
+ - ./tools/travis-before-install.sh
script:
- ./tools/travis-test.sh